Red wine capital of the world: Bordeaux

Bordeaux is a port city on the Garonne River in southwest France, the capital of the Aquitaine region.

Grand Théâtre de Bordeaux first inaugurated on 17 April 1780 was restored in 1991 is one of the oldest wooden frame opera houses in Europe home to the Opéra National de Bordeaux, as well as the Ballet National de Bordeaux.

Bordeaux Cathedral is a national monument of France, was consecrated by Pope Urban II in 1096. The Royal Gate is from the early 13th century, while the rest of the construction is mostly from the 14th-15th centuries. Located next to the cathedral is the Tour Pey-Berland, named for architect Pey Berland.  This tower dates back to 1440 and is among Bordeaux’s definitive locations.

Grosse Cloche or the great bell gate standing atop the St. Eloi gate commenced Bordeaux’s major happenings prior to the Liberation. An elegant clock that hails from the 17th century offsets the belfry.

Esplanade des Quinconces is Europe’s largest Square built in 1827 to celebrate the city’s growing presence in navigation and commerce. Place Gambetta built in 1770 is the heart of the city with numerous shopping and dining options, magnificent facades and beautiful landscaped garden.

Rue Sainte-Catherine is the longest shopping street in Europe full of shops, restaurants and cafés.

Bordeaux – Wine Tourism

The city of Bordeaux is the wine center of France. If you have ever experienced a glass of wine from there you will have an affinity for the city. Bordeaux is a whole region of France producing a huge range of styles- from crisp, dry whites to high class reds as well as some of world’s best sweet wines.

CIVB

Le Conseil Interprofessionnel du Vin de Bordeaux is a French interest group that represents nearly 10,000 wine producers and growers. The organization seeks to promote its members interests on national and international level.

Wine Tourism Information

The Bordeaux tourist office offers a number of tourism itineraries that start from the city center. The guides there are trained by the CIVB.

CIVB Wine Bar

Bordeaux Wine Festival

In 2010 the 7th annual wine festival took place. It was from 24 to 27 June on the banks of the Gironde River. It is usually visited by roughly half a million people. The CIVB School organizes wine tastings for the event.

The Wine Cultural Center

The center is a daring project to design and construct a cultural center dedicated to wine. The budget is at 55 million euro and is planned to be completed by 2013. It is intended to be attractive with its content and architecture. Among the greatest investors in the project are the Bordeaux City Council, the greater Bordeaux metropolitan area, the CIVB, and the Bordeaux Chamber of Commerce.

The CIVB Wine School

Founded in 1990, the school is corner stone of CIVB. The school offers innovative courses for wine buffs, beginners, journalists and members of the trade from France and abroad. SO far more than 31,000 have been trained by the school or in one of its 26 subsidiaries abroad.
